Abstract

Oil and gas industrial is one of the most important industries especially to developing
country. Experienced by the author along the eight months industrial training at
PETRONAS Gas Berhad (PGB) Kerteh, the surroundings require active researches
and developments in attempt to accumulate efficiency or maintaining plant services.
At gas processing plant ( GPP), one of the most important equipment is heat exchanger
which widely used to vary temperature of hydrocarbon or water. During the industrial
training, numerous shutdowns of heat exchanger were attributed to failure of the heat
exchanger, especially the tubes. Consequently, the failure of the tubes part leads the
management to replace the heat exchanger and fabricate new equipment. This
decision been made because of insufficient time to solve the problem in detail and to
continue operation.
A study was conducted into the failure of the heat exchanger. Design of the heat
exchanger and operation parameters were scrutinized. In addition, samples of the
failed heat exchanger tubes were obtained and studied using various failure analysis
tools such as X -ray, optical examination and SEM.
In conclusion, this investigation reveals that corrosion was the main factor in the
fuilure ofthe heat exchanger tubes.
